Pubertal Growth Spurt
A rapid increase in height and weight during puberty, resulting from accelerated bone growth.
Temperament
An individual's inherent personality traits, including mood, emotionality, and behavior tendencies, often observable in infancy.
Slow-To-Warm-Up
A temperament in some children who are cautious in new situations or with unfamiliar people, but gradually become more comfortable over time.
Basal Metabolic Rate
The number of calories required to keep your body functioning at rest, a crucial component of overall metabolism.
